WebDao De Jing. The philosophy of Daoism has two main texts. The primary one is called the Dao De Jing (道德經). Dao De Jing means the Way of Virtue Scripture. It is said that Laozi wrote the Dao De Jing. The secondary text called the Zhuangzi (莊子). These texts are said to have been written before the Qin book burning campaign during which ...

Laozi : Daode jing. The Daode jing is a short book of about 5,000 Chinese characters. It has 81 short chapters. It has two parts: Part One is the D ao jing (道經), which is chapters 1–37; Part Two is the De jing (德經), which is chapters 38–81.
